Transaction 56e8ba977dd4218c3a71e12de668e2ff42e772bfb140173650940a92fbd89b8e

2 Input
2 Outputs
  • 56e8ba977dd4218c3a71e12de668e2ff42e772bfb140173650940a92fbd89b8e:0
  • value  1000000
    address  3FE1JZWPBU2apZ5pax2fbsVNCozjHxGK45
  • 56e8ba977dd4218c3a71e12de668e2ff42e772bfb140173650940a92fbd89b8e:1
  • value  17685278
    address  3EX6nsrgHuP55GRdeK5dHrpxXEyxpgKRui